怎么开两个摄像头?


#1

树莓派中用ArduSub的镜像系统,使用MJPG视频流,无法开两个摄像头???用树莓派的原生系统RASPBIAN LITE(与Pixhawk不兼容)就可以?还是有其它解决方案?


#2

老实说没有很明白你的问题,不过大概了解你的意思,一个简单的方式,你通过web实现另一个摄像头的mjpeg监视,还是能达到比较好的帧率的。

这个问答对解决你的问题有帮助。
https://stackoverflow.com/questions/19346775/rendering-mjpeg-stream-in-html5


Rov出来多个视频信号的方案
#3

raspberry
使用树莓派中ArduSub的镜像系统ardusub-raspbian一直没有安装成功过MJPG视频流,会出现上图的错误提示,原因也一直没找到???使用树莓派原生系统raspbian-stretch-lite就可以成功安装MJPG视频流,也可以开两个摄像头。不知道是什么原因?


#4

你上一个步骤就没有成功,就是git clone这条命令执行没有成功,你注意下错误提示,错误提示你没有这个目录,你确认下该目录是否存在,不要完全照搬教程命令,看下什么意思再操作。


#5

提示的意思是已经存在了‘mjpg-streamer’路径并且非空,说明已经git clone成功了。这个截图上的指令纯粹是为了截图而进行的一次操作,之前已经git clone过,并提示下载成功,当时没有截图下来。应该不是这个问题。raspbian-ardusub是基于树莓派raspbian-jessie系统开发的,我怀疑是树莓派raspbian-jessie系统本身不支持mjpg-steamer。目前正在探索。。。


#6

build 打不开目录是因为写错路径了。。。但是make all无法编译??出现图中的错误提示,这是什么原因?依赖包安装是成功的。。如下
sudo apt-get install subversion
sudo apt-get install libjpeg8-dev
sudo apt-get install imagemagick
sudo apt-get install libv4l-dev
sudo apt-get install cmake


#7

无法make all编译是因为当前登入树莓派的用户权限不够,改为root用户登入就可以了,代码如下,之后就可以打开mjpg-streamer了。

*****登录root账户
先设置密码
sudo passwd root
输入两次密码后(无提示)
登录root账户
su root



#8

您好,请问一下实现两个摄像头传画面,需要怎么配置环境?树苺派和电脑只有一个ip,用两个摄像头ip地址都写一样的么?


#9

树莓派采用mjpg_streamer视频流(百度一下“mjpg_streamer双开摄像头”,教程很多),同一ip下,不同端口号,如192.168.2.2:8080,另一个为192.168.2.2:8081


#10

好的,谢谢